Paco Xu
|
bdb51f28df
|
fix a typo in kubeadm v1beta4 doc
|
2024-07-25 22:01:04 +08:00 |
|
Daman Arora
|
5359098c14
|
kube-proxy: internal config: fuzz cidr values for unit tests
Signed-off-by: Daman Arora <aroradaman@gmail.com>
|
2024-07-25 19:20:24 +05:30 |
|
Lan Liang
|
9a8d6b72e4
|
Using NewExpressions for cel lazy test.
Signed-off-by: Lan Liang <gcslyp@gmail.com>
|
2024-07-25 13:32:48 +00:00 |
|
Kubernetes Prow Robot
|
b95f9c32d6
|
Merge pull request #126282 from macsko/fix_scheduler_perf_tests_taking_too_long
Init etcd and apiserver per test case in scheduler_perf integration tests
|
2024-07-25 02:04:46 -07:00 |
|
Maciej Skoczeń
|
98be7dfc5d
|
Change structure of NodeToStatus map in scheduler
|
2024-07-25 07:48:35 +00:00 |
|
bzsuni
|
4ad2cd9299
|
Update etcd from v3.5.14 to v3.5.15
Signed-off-by: bzsuni <bingzhe.sun@daocloud.io>
|
2024-07-25 10:48:34 +08:00 |
|
Kubernetes Prow Robot
|
6ac20677c7
|
Merge pull request #126274 from ConnorJC3/flaky-vac-test
De-flake VAC tests by returning new PVC from WaitForVolumeModification
|
2024-07-24 15:39:52 -07:00 |
|
Mike Spreitzer
|
77541c1e35
|
Relax noise margin in TestOneWeightedHistogram
Signed-off-by: Mike Spreitzer <mspreitz@us.ibm.com>
|
2024-07-24 17:45:12 -04:00 |
|
Anish Ramasekar
|
71d7e29954
|
cleanup unused fn IsValidServiceAccountKeyFile in authenticator config
Signed-off-by: Anish Ramasekar <anish.ramasekar@gmail.com>
|
2024-07-24 14:35:21 -07:00 |
|
Kubernetes Prow Robot
|
df69a528d5
|
Merge pull request #126335 from kannon92/split-filesystem-fix
[KEP-4191]: Move container fs check so that we only check if system is split
|
2024-07-24 13:55:09 -07:00 |
|
devppratik
|
f8bf6b97b8
|
Update Node Monitor Grace Period default duration to 50s
Update description
Improve flag comment
Update Test case value to be 50s by default
Update Description
Run make update
Minor description fix
|
2024-07-24 22:54:44 +05:30 |
|
Kubernetes Prow Robot
|
696ad19801
|
Merge pull request #126242 from bzsuni/bz/etcd/build/v3.5.15
Build etcd image of v3.5.15
|
2024-07-24 09:53:53 -07:00 |
|
Kevin Hannon
|
3e642aee3f
|
move container fs check so that we only check if system is split
|
2024-07-24 11:22:23 -04:00 |
|
Jefftree
|
56b278d5d2
|
fix flake in TestLeaseCandidateCleanup
|
2024-07-24 14:41:13 +00:00 |
|
Jefftree
|
919e7abe0f
|
update codegen and openapi
|
2024-07-24 14:41:13 +00:00 |
|
Jefftree
|
0c774d0b1f
|
Change PingTime to be persistent
|
2024-07-24 14:41:13 +00:00 |
|
Dr. Stefan Schimanski
|
a738daa88a
|
Review feedback: fix context handling in LeaseCandidateGCController
Signed-off-by: Dr. Stefan Schimanski <stefan.schimanski@gmail.com>
|
2024-07-24 14:38:13 +00:00 |
|
Dr. Stefan Schimanski
|
15affefcab
|
Review feedback: handle non-kube strategy correctly
Signed-off-by: Dr. Stefan Schimanski <stefan.schimanski@gmail.com>
|
2024-07-24 14:38:13 +00:00 |
|
Jefftree
|
6407f32db2
|
fix etcd data
|
2024-07-24 14:38:13 +00:00 |
|
Jefftree
|
e1ea24a171
|
fix ordering issue in candidates
|
2024-07-24 14:38:13 +00:00 |
|
Dr. Stefan Schimanski
|
a64418ba0a
|
Review feedback
Signed-off-by: Dr. Stefan Schimanski <stefan.schimanski@gmail.com>
|
2024-07-24 14:38:13 +00:00 |
|
Jefftree
|
42678f1553
|
regen clients
|
2024-07-24 14:38:12 +00:00 |
|
Jefftree
|
fac7581640
|
feedback: leasecandidate clients
|
2024-07-24 14:38:12 +00:00 |
|
Dr. Stefan Schimanski
|
68226b0501
|
Review feedback
Signed-off-by: Dr. Stefan Schimanski <stefan.schimanski@gmail.com>
|
2024-07-24 14:38:12 +00:00 |
|
Jefftree
|
e0c6987ca8
|
add gc and improve testing
|
2024-07-24 14:38:11 +00:00 |
|
Jefftree
|
c47ff1e1a9
|
CLE controller and client changes
|
2024-07-24 14:38:11 +00:00 |
|
Jefftree
|
b5a62f14cd
|
CLE rbac for lease and leasecandidate in kube-system
|
2024-07-24 14:38:11 +00:00 |
|
Jefftree
|
9b16b0dc97
|
CLE feature gate
|
2024-07-24 14:38:11 +00:00 |
|
Jefftree
|
e3e56eb1e2
|
CLE storage and type registration changes
|
2024-07-24 14:38:11 +00:00 |
|
Jefftree
|
3999b98c88
|
Coordinated Leader Election Alpha API
|
2024-07-24 14:38:10 +00:00 |
|
Kubernetes Prow Robot
|
ab470aad01
|
Merge pull request #126220 from saschagrunert/image-volumesource-e2e
[KEP-4639] Add `ImageVolumeSource` node e2e tests
|
2024-07-24 06:40:50 -07:00 |
|
Sascha Grunert
|
bc452887fa
|
Add ImageVolumeSource e2e tests
Signed-off-by: Sascha Grunert <sgrunert@redhat.com>
|
2024-07-24 13:57:39 +02:00 |
|
Kubernetes Prow Robot
|
ceb58a4dbc
|
Merge pull request #126323 from saschagrunert/image-volume-runtime-panic
Fix runtime panic in imagevolume `CanSupport` method
|
2024-07-24 04:57:06 -07:00 |
|
Kubernetes Prow Robot
|
a145f1508d
|
Merge pull request #125087 from carlory/volumeoptions
remove volumeoptions from VolumePlugin and BlockVolumePlugin
|
2024-07-24 02:24:20 -07:00 |
|
Sascha Grunert
|
a43cc08ffb
|
Fix runtime panic in imagevolume CanSupport method
The following tests are failing right now:
- ci-kubernetes-e2e-ec2-alpha-enabled-default
- ci-kubernetes-e2e-gci-gce-alpha-enabled-default
Because of:
```
goroutine 347 [running]:
k8s.io/apimachinery/pkg/util/runtime.logPanic({0x33092b0, 0x4d6ed00}, {0x296a7e0, 0x4c20c10})
k8s.io/apimachinery/pkg/util/runtime/runtime.go:107 +0xbc
k8s.io/apimachinery/pkg/util/runtime.handleCrash({0x33092b0, 0x4d6ed00}, {0x296a7e0, 0x4c20c10}, {0x4d6ed00, 0x0, 0x1000000004400a5?})
k8s.io/apimachinery/pkg/util/runtime/runtime.go:82 +0x5e
k8s.io/apimachinery/pkg/util/runtime.HandleCrash({0x0, 0x0, 0xc000517be8?})
k8s.io/apimachinery/pkg/util/runtime/runtime.go:59 +0x108
panic({0x296a7e0?, 0x4c20c10?})
runtime/panic.go:770 +0x132
k8s.io/kubernetes/pkg/volume/image.(*imagePlugin).CanSupport(0xc00183d140?, 0xc0006a2600?)
k8s.io/kubernetes/pkg/volume/image/image.go:52 +0x3
k8s.io/kubernetes/pkg/volume.(*VolumePluginMgr).FindPluginBySpec(0xc0008a1388, 0xc000f7ddb8)
k8s.io/kubernetes/pkg/volume/plugins.go:637 +0x208
k8s.io/kubernetes/pkg/kubelet/volumemanager/cache.(*desiredStateOfWorld).AddPodToVolume(0xc000517bc0, {0xc000e94a50, 0x24}, 0xc00172b208, 0xc000f7ddb8, {0xc0017892a0, 0xe}, {0xc000a4d6ec, 0x3}, {0xc000978af0, ...})
k8s.io/kubernetes/pkg/kubelet/volumemanager/cache/desired_state_of_world.go:270 +0xf2
k8s.io/kubernetes/pkg/kubelet/volumemanager/populator.(*desiredStateOfWorldPopulator).processPodVolumes(0xc0003e6700, 0xc00172b208, 0xc00183ddd8)
k8s.io/kubernetes/pkg/kubelet/volumemanager/populator/desired_state_of_world_populator.go:319 +0x685
k8s.io/kubernetes/pkg/kubelet/volumemanager/populator.(*desiredStateOfWorldPopulator).findAndAddNewPods(0xc0003e6700)
k8s.io/kubernetes/pkg/kubelet/volumemanager/populator/desired_state_of_world_populator.go:204 +0x2dc
k8s.io/kubernetes/pkg/kubelet/volumemanager/populator.(*desiredStateOfWorldPopulator).populatorLoop(0xc0003e6700)
k8s.io/kubernetes/pkg/kubelet/volumemanager/populator/desired_state_of_world_populator.go:173 +0x18
k8s.io/apimachinery/pkg/util/wait.BackoffUntil.func1(0xc000905eb0?)
k8s.io/apimachinery/pkg/util/wait/backoff.go:226 +0x33
k8s.io/apimachinery/pkg/util/wait.BackoffUntil(0xc00183df70, {0x32d7340, 0xc000a7be60}, 0x1, 0xc0000b2660)
k8s.io/apimachinery/pkg/util/wait/backoff.go:227 +0xaf
k8s.io/apimachinery/pkg/util/wait.JitterUntil(0xc000f8bf70, 0x5f5e100, 0x0, 0x1, 0xc0000b2660)
k8s.io/apimachinery/pkg/util/wait/backoff.go:204 +0x7f
k8s.io/apimachinery/pkg/util/wait.Until(...)
k8s.io/apimachinery/pkg/util/wait/backoff.go:161
k8s.io/kubernetes/pkg/kubelet/volumemanager/populator.(*desiredStateOfWorldPopulator).Run(0xc0003e6700, {0x32e3228, 0xc000b3faa0}, 0xc0000b2660)
k8s.io/kubernetes/pkg/kubelet/volumemanager/populator/desired_state_of_world_populator.go:158 +0x1a5
created by k8s.io/kubernetes/pkg/kubelet/volumemanager.(*volumeManager).Run in goroutine 335
k8s.io/kubernetes/pkg/kubelet/volumemanager/volume_manager.go:286 +0x14f
```
Fixes https://github.com/kubernetes/kubernetes/issues/126317
Signed-off-by: Sascha Grunert <sgrunert@redhat.com>
|
2024-07-24 09:54:03 +02:00 |
|
Maciej Skoczeń
|
6b33e2e632
|
Use generics in scheduling queue's heap
|
2024-07-24 06:55:47 +00:00 |
|
carlory
|
c4851c64a0
|
remove volumeoptions from VolumePlugin and BlockVolumePlugin
|
2024-07-24 14:07:02 +08:00 |
|
googs1025
|
9eaede70ed
|
call close method when finish profileMap in ut
|
2024-07-24 13:15:07 +08:00 |
|
Kubernetes Prow Robot
|
57d197fb89
|
Merge pull request #124430 from AllenXu93/fix-kubelet-restart-notReady
fix node notReady in first sync period after kubelet restart
|
2024-07-23 21:20:40 -07:00 |
|
Kubernetes Prow Robot
|
c75e30d049
|
Merge pull request #126294 from aojea/nosnat
e2e test for No SNAT
|
2024-07-23 20:12:33 -07:00 |
|
Kubernetes Prow Robot
|
5af1710d90
|
Merge pull request #126243 from SergeyKanzhelev/devicePluginFailures
Implement resource health in pod status (KEP 4680)
|
2024-07-23 20:12:24 -07:00 |
|
Kubernetes Prow Robot
|
49ff255074
|
Merge pull request #126308 from cici37/hotFix
Update with stdlib errors
|
2024-07-23 18:02:07 -07:00 |
|
Kubernetes Prow Robot
|
59776b57e7
|
Merge pull request #126306 from siyuanfoundation/env-var
Add KUBE_EMULATED_VERSION env variable to set the emulated-version of scheduler and controller manager.
|
2024-07-23 18:02:00 -07:00 |
|
Kubernetes Prow Robot
|
d97cf3a1eb
|
Merge pull request #126303 from bart0sh/PR150-dra-refactor-checkpoint-upstream
DRA: refactor checkpointing
|
2024-07-23 18:01:53 -07:00 |
|
Kubernetes Prow Robot
|
39a80796b6
|
Merge pull request #122628 from sanposhiho/pod-smaller-events
add(scheduler/framework): implement smaller Pod update events
|
2024-07-23 18:01:46 -07:00 |
|
Kubernetes Prow Robot
|
638128e74f
|
Merge pull request #119019 from gjkim42/add-e2e-node-test-restarting-the-kubelet
Add node serial e2e tests that simulate the kubelet restart
|
2024-07-23 18:01:36 -07:00 |
|
Sergey Kanzhelev
|
62f96d2748
|
set AllocatedResourcesStatus in the Pod Status
|
2024-07-24 00:29:35 +00:00 |
|
Sergey Kanzhelev
|
3790ee2fe8
|
reset fields when the feature gate was not set
|
2024-07-24 00:29:35 +00:00 |
|
Sergey Kanzhelev
|
2253b53b58
|
generated files
|
2024-07-24 00:29:35 +00:00 |
|
Sergey Kanzhelev
|
16e8911fdc
|
add AllocatedResourcesStatus field to ContainerStatus
|
2024-07-24 00:29:34 +00:00 |
|